Coronel Altino Machado Airport serves Governador Valadares, a mid-sized city in the eastern portion of Minas Gerais, Brazil. The airport primarily handles domestic regional flights and connects the region to major hubs like Belo Horizonte and São Paulo. Governador Valadares is renowned internationally as one of the world's leading gemstone trading centers, particularly for aquamarines and topaz, making the airport an important gateway for gemstone buyers and sellers.
